Style South brings Fashion Week to The Shops Buckhead Atlanta

With two solid days of fashion shows and fashion parties, The Shops Buckhead Atlanta may have just created Fashion Week in Atlanta. The open-to-public event featured the Fall 2016 collections from many of their top retailers - talk about staying on trend with the "show now shop now" fashion movement. 

On Saturday, September 17, Style South hosted the finale runway show at The Shops Buckhead Atlanta. Hundreds of guests and VIPs sipped on champagne at the luxury shopping destination while taking their seats and eagerly awaiting the runway show which showcased the latest looks from Alice + Olivia by Stacey Bendet, Canali, Les Copains and Etro.

Alice + Olivia by Stacey Bendet opened the show with their signature edgy glam for the modern woman. Canali followed with a classic collection of menswear. They featured a black and white houndstooth trench that stole the show. The third collection, by Les Copains, was an ethereal show-stopper with it's lace, layering and proportion. Closing out the annual Style South with a collection of menswear and womenswear was Etro. No one mixes color and pattern more successfully and elegantly than Etro.

Carolina Herrera Spring 2017 NYFW

Elegance and sophistication are in the DNA of the Carolina Herrera brand and Mrs. Herrera herself of course. She never fails to deliver collections that epitomize class and femininity. This season however, we saw a modernity that is new to CH. The classic silhouette remained in place but the cut, fit and construction had a newness about it that could only mean one thing - there is new blood at the core of the brand.

Former Oscar de la Renta designers, Fernando Garcia and Laura Kim worked with the legendary designer right up to his death. At the time, Garcia and Kim launched their own label they call Monse. Almost simultaneously, they moved to the creative team at Carolina Herrera. Hence, a fresher, edgier and younger collection is born.
